Kiwanis Club Hosts Christmas Walk

Tour eight homes decked out for the holidays.

Update: Advance ticket discount extended to Wednesday, Nov. 28.

The Kiwanis Club of Caldwell-West Essex will once again host, “The Christmas Walk,” a self-guided tour of homes decorated for the holiday season.

The tour is set for Sunday, Dec. 2, from noon to 4:30 p.m

Six local homes and two historic 19th-century homes will be decked out for the holidays in this special fundraiser. A host at each house will be available to answer questions about the distinctive collections and unique décor.

Complimentary refreshments will be served at Caldwell Flowerland, 329 Bloomfield Ave., in Caldwell, as well as at the two historic sites, the Grover Cleveland Birthplace in Caldwell and the Zenas Crane Homestead in West Caldwell. Admission is $25, $30 after Wednesday, Nov. 28. Tickets and maps will be available at Caldwell Flowerland on the day of walk.

Proceeds will go to the programs sponsored by the Kiwanis Club of Caldwell-West Essex, which include Builders Clubs, Key Clubs and Circle K at local schools, the Caldwell Food Pantry, a battered women's shelter, and local families in need.

To complete the day, five local restaurants will offer special discounts to tour ticket holders.
